HomeMy WebLinkAbout14566 ORD - 10/18/1978jkh:10- 18- 78;lst AN ORDINANCE AMENDING THE ZONING ORDINANCE OF THE CITY OF CORPUS CHRISTI ADOPTED ON THE 27TH DAY OF AUGUST, 1937, APPEARING OF RECORD IN VOLUME 9, PAGES 565, ET SEQ, OF THE ORDINANCE AND RESOLUTION RECORDS, AS AMENDED . FROM TIME TO TIME AND PARTICULARLY AS AMENDED BY ORDINANCE NO. 6106, AS AMENDED, UPON APPLICATION OF CITY OF CORPS CHRISTI BY AMENDING THE ZONING MAP BY CHANGING THE ZONING ON 10.82± ACRE TRACT OF LAND OUT OF LOT 4 SECTION 9 BOHEMIAN COLONY LANDS SITUATED IN THE CITY OF CORPUS CHRISTI, NUECES COUNTY, TEXAS, FROM "A -1" APARTMENT HOUSE DISTRICT AND "B -4" GENERAL BUSINESS DISTRICT TO "B -3" BUSINESS DISTRICT ; KEEPING IN EFFECT ALL OTHER PROVISIONS OF THE EXISTING ORDINANCE AS AMENDED; REPEALING ALL ORDINANCES IN CONFLICT HEREWITH; AND DECLARING AN EMERGENCY. WHEREAS, the Planning Commission has forwarded to the City Council its reports and recommendations concerning the application of City of Corpus Christi for amendment to the zoning map of the City of Corpus Christi; and WHEREAS, public hearing was held at which hearing all persons wishing to appear and be heard were heard, to consider the same before the City Council of the City of Corpus Christi, in accordance with proper notice to the public, said public hearing having been held on Wednesday , October 18, 1978 , at Regular Council Meeting of the City Council in the Council Chamber at City Hall in the City of Corpus Christi; and WHEREAS, by motion duly made, seconded and carried, it was decided by the City Council that to approve the hereinafter set forth amendment would best serve public health, necessity and convenience and the general welfare of the City of Corpus Christi and its citizens: N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CORPUS CHRISTI, TEXAS: SECTION 1. That the zoning of the following described parcel or tract out of Lot 4, Section 9, Bohemian Colony Lands, situated in the City of Corpus Christi, Nueces County, Texas, be and the same is hereby changed from "A -1" Apartment House District and "B -4" General Business District to "B -3" Business District: FIELDNOTES for a 10.818 acre tract of land out of Lot 4, Section 9, Bohemian Colony Lands, a map of which is recorded in Volume A, Page 48, map records of Nueces County, Texas: BEGINNING at a point on the Northwest right -of -way line 'of Weber Road for the most Easterly South corner of this survey from which corner the intersection of the centerline of said Weber Road and the centerline of Saratoga Boulevard bears South 61 °00100" East 40.00 feet and South 29 °00100" West 155.00 feet; , THENCE North 87 °58'00" West with said right -of -way line 213.16 feet and a point on the Northeast right -of -way Iine of said Saratoga Boulevard for the most Westerly South corner of this survey; THENCE North 61 °30'00" West with said Northeas= right -of -way line of Saratoga Boulevard 1,090.75 feet and a point for the South corner of Lot 4, Socurek Addition a map of which is recorded in Volume 27, Page 2, map records of Nueces County, Texas, for the West corner of this survey; THENCE North 29 °00'00" East with the Southeast.boundary of said Lot 4, 375.00 feet for the North corner of this survey; THENCE South 61 "30100" East 1,280.74 feet and a point on said Northwest right -of -way line of Weber Road for the East corner of this survey; THENCE South 29 °00'00" West with said Northwest right -of -way line of Weber Road 280.00 feet to the POINT OF BEGINNING.' SECTION 3. That the official zoning map of the City of Corpus Christi, Texas, be, and the same is hereby, amended as herein ordained. SECTION 4. That the Zoning Ordinance and Map of the City of Corpus Christi, Texas, approved on the 27th day of August, 1937, as amended from time to time, except as herein changed, shall remain in full force and effect. SECTION 5. That all ordinances or parts of ordinances in conflict herewith are hereby expressly repealed. SECTION 6.
